This is a fork of the Gnome shell kitchen timer extension that allows running multiple simultaneous timers, but has not been updated for 2 years.
To install the extension, clone the repository and run install_local.sh
:
mkdir ~/github
cd ~/github
git clone https:/CryptoD/tasksTimer
cd tasksTimer
./install_local.sh
and then restart gnome shell to enable (Alt-F2 'r') or logout/login.
After installation, restart gnome shell to enable the extension (use Alt-F2 'r' or logout/login).
There are currently two global keyboard shortcuts, which can be enabled in Preferences/Options:
<ctrl><super>T
- show end time in panel<ctrl><super>K
- stop next timer to expire
You can also edit the shortcuts in dconf-editor or with the following script:
$ [email protected]/bin/dconf-editor.sh
You can specify alarms as timers with the following syntax:
name @ HH[:MM[:SS[.ms]]] [am|pm]
The time_spec
can include am/pm or use 24-hour time.
Examples:
alarm @ 5am
alarm @ 11:30pm
alarm @ 23:30
alarm @ 8:45:00.444am
To create an alarm timer that goes off at 5am tomorrow:

Click the regular timer icon for a running timer to make the alarm persistent. The icon will change to an alarm clock. The pool timer alarm will ring persistently until the notification is closed, while the tea alarm will ring as defined in the play sound setting.
